[PATCH] pcmcia: new suspend core
Move the suspend and resume methods out of the event handler, and into special functions. Also use these functions for pre- and post-reset, as almost all drivers already do, and the remaining ones can easily be converted. Bugfix to include/pcmcia/ds.c Signed-off-by:Andrew Morton <akpm@osdl.org> Signed-off-by:
Dominik Brodowski <linux@dominikbrodowski.net>
Showing
- Documentation/pcmcia/driver-changes.txt 6 additions, 0 deletionsDocumentation/pcmcia/driver-changes.txt
- drivers/bluetooth/bluecard_cs.c 23 additions, 14 deletionsdrivers/bluetooth/bluecard_cs.c
- drivers/bluetooth/bt3c_cs.c 23 additions, 14 deletionsdrivers/bluetooth/bt3c_cs.c
- drivers/bluetooth/btuart_cs.c 24 additions, 14 deletionsdrivers/bluetooth/btuart_cs.c
- drivers/bluetooth/dtl1_cs.c 23 additions, 14 deletionsdrivers/bluetooth/dtl1_cs.c
- drivers/char/pcmcia/cm4000_cs.c 34 additions, 27 deletionsdrivers/char/pcmcia/cm4000_cs.c
- drivers/char/pcmcia/cm4040_cs.c 25 additions, 25 deletionsdrivers/char/pcmcia/cm4040_cs.c
- drivers/char/pcmcia/synclink_cs.c 29 additions, 18 deletionsdrivers/char/pcmcia/synclink_cs.c
- drivers/ide/legacy/ide-cs.c 24 additions, 14 deletionsdrivers/ide/legacy/ide-cs.c
- drivers/isdn/hardware/avm/avm_cs.c 24 additions, 14 deletionsdrivers/isdn/hardware/avm/avm_cs.c
- drivers/isdn/hisax/avma1_cs.c 24 additions, 14 deletionsdrivers/isdn/hisax/avma1_cs.c
- drivers/isdn/hisax/elsa_cs.c 28 additions, 18 deletionsdrivers/isdn/hisax/elsa_cs.c
- drivers/isdn/hisax/sedlbauer_cs.c 28 additions, 22 deletionsdrivers/isdn/hisax/sedlbauer_cs.c
- drivers/isdn/hisax/teles_cs.c 28 additions, 18 deletionsdrivers/isdn/hisax/teles_cs.c
- drivers/mtd/maps/pcmciamtd.c 20 additions, 16 deletionsdrivers/mtd/maps/pcmciamtd.c
- drivers/net/pcmcia/3c574_cs.c 34 additions, 22 deletionsdrivers/net/pcmcia/3c574_cs.c
- drivers/net/pcmcia/3c589_cs.c 34 additions, 22 deletionsdrivers/net/pcmcia/3c589_cs.c
- drivers/net/pcmcia/axnet_cs.c 36 additions, 23 deletionsdrivers/net/pcmcia/axnet_cs.c
- drivers/net/pcmcia/com20020_cs.c 38 additions, 24 deletionsdrivers/net/pcmcia/com20020_cs.c
- drivers/net/pcmcia/fmvj18x_cs.c 35 additions, 22 deletionsdrivers/net/pcmcia/fmvj18x_cs.c
Loading
Please register or sign in to comment